The details

The threat investigation triggered the evacuation of North Oconee High School, and a precautionary lockdown at the nearby Rocky Branch Elementary. The ongoing investigation and deployment of additional resources highlight the challenge of quickly assessing credibility and separating plausible threats from noise in the initial hours of an incident.

  • The threat investigation and evacuation occurred on the morning of April 11, 2026.
